What is the auditory canal's primary function?

Explanation:
The primary function of the auditory canal is to direct sound waves to the eardrum. This tubular structure connects the outer ear to the eardrum and plays a crucial role in the process of hearing. Sound waves from the environment enter the auditory canal and travel through this passage, ultimately causing the eardrum to vibrate. These vibrations are then transmitted further into the ear for processing, allowing us to perceive sound. While the auditory canal does have additional roles, such as providing some level of protection to the eardrum and helping to maintain ear health, its fundamental purpose is to facilitate the transmission of sound waves toward the eardrum. This is essential for normal auditory function, as it ensures that sound vibrations are effectively delivered to the inner structures of the ear where they can be transformed into neural signals.
